Transaction fbdfc2ab3ab0273370f05f064c3815ce717084bcff4359615a97cbb9203a37d2
1 Input
1 Output
-
fbdfc2ab3ab0273370f05f064c3815ce717084bcff4359615a97cbb9203a37d2:0
- value
- 586586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a6fe0799730bcdc9f93521840c42c65e960025b OP_EQUAL
- address
- 3CrQPHcZM1s79VRBN2xBvzsLwhMGWuJWE2